saludos, armé un pequeño script para mostrar los ultimos temas de mi foro, pero tengo un extraño problema: En el servidor local funciona perfectamente, pero cuando cargo el script a mi servidor me encuentro con que no muestra nada.
Tras revisar TODO me encontré con un error que no logro solucionar. Si en la con sulta a mysql, pongo "order by" o limit x" siplemente no lo muestra en mi hosting, aunque si lo hace con wamp en el servidor local y lo mismo en ubuntu con LAMP.
Pego el código en cuestión-
Código PHP:
<?php
include('configuracion.php');
header('Content-Type: text/xml');
echo "<?xml version=\"1.0\" encoding=\"utf-8\"?>";
echo "<rss version=\"2.0\">";
?>
<channel>
<title>"Desconectate"</title>
<link>"www.desconectate.info"</link>
<description>Noticias de www.desconectate.info</description>
<language>"es_ES"</language>
<?
$result=mysql_query("select * FROM foro order by id desc", $con);
while ($row=mysql_fetch_array($result))
{
$titulo=$row['titulo'];
$idm=$row['idm'];
$id=$row['id'];
$url_doc=htmlspecialchars("http://www.desconectate.info/temas.php?id=$id&t=$idm");
echo "<item>
<title>".$titulo."</title>
<link>".$url_doc."</link>
</item>";}?>
</channel>
</rss>